In three-dimensional geometry, skew lines are two lines that do not intersect and are not parallel.A simple example of a pair of skew lines is the pair of lines through opposite edges of a regular tetrahedron.Two lines that both lie in the same plane must either cross each other or be parallel, so skew lines can exist only in three or more dimensions. the complex voltage across either port is proportional to the complex current flowing into it when there are no reflections), and the two ports are assumed to be interchangeable.
